/**
* A list of TMCH claims labels and their associated claims keys.
*
* <p>The claims list is actually sharded into multiple {@link ClaimsListShard} entities to work
* around the Datastore limitation of 1M max size per entity. However, when calling {@link
* #getFromDatastore} all of the shards are recombined into one {@link ClaimsListShard} object.
*
* <p>ClaimsList shards are tied to a specific revision and are persisted individually, then the
* entire claims list is atomically shifted over to using the new shards by persisting the new
* revision object and updating the {@link ClaimsListSingleton} pointing to it. This bypasses the
* 10MB per transaction limit.
*
* <p>Therefore, it is never OK to save an instance of this class directly to Datastore. Instead you
* must use the {@link #saveToDatastore} method to do it for you.
*
* <p>Note that the primary key of this entity is {@link #revisionId}, which is auto-generated by
* the database. So, if a retry of insertion happens after the previous attempt unexpectedly
* succeeds, we will end up with having two exact same claims list with only different {@link
* #revisionId}. However, this is not an actual problem because we only use the claims list with
* highest {@link #revisionId}.
*
* <p>TODO(b/162007765): Rename the class to ClaimsList and remove Datastore related fields and
* methods.
* <p>TODO(b/162007765): Remove Datastore related fields and methods.
*/
